ubuntu 系统安装 CosLogin Browser
本文介绍在 Ubuntu 24.04 系统中,通过 VMware Workstation Pro 环境安装 CosLogin Browser 的完整步骤,包括 SSH 配置、安装包获取及命令行安装方法。
概述
本文介绍在 Ubuntu 24.04 桌面版系统中安装 CosLogin Browser 的完整流程。CosLogin Browser 是用于登录腾讯云对象存储(COS)的专用工具,安装后您可以通过图形化界面便捷管理存储桶资源。我们以 VMware Workstation Pro 中已部署的 ubuntu-24.04-desktop-amd64 虚拟机为例,帮助您快速完成环境准备和软件安装。
前提条件
开始安装前,请确认以下条件已满足:
- 您已通过 VMware Workstation Pro 安装好 Ubuntu 24.04 桌面版,且系统可正常登录并连接网络。
- 当前登录用户具有
sudo权限,能够执行需要管理员特权的命令。 - (可选)如计划通过远程方式传输安装包,需确保 Ubuntu 系统已配置网络并能被局域网其他主机访问。
安装 SSH 服务(用于文件传输)
如果您希望通过 scp、sftp 等工具将安装包从其他电脑上传至 Ubuntu,请先安装并启动 OpenSSH 服务。如果打算直接在 Ubuntu 内用浏览器下载,可跳过此步骤。
- 打开终端,执行以下命令安装 openssh-server:
sudo apt update
sudo apt install openssh-server -y
- 启动 SSH 服务并设置为开机自启(推荐):
sudo systemctl start ssh
sudo systemctl enable ssh
- 检查 SSH 服务状态,确认已正常运行:
sudo systemctl status ssh
状态显示 active (running) 表示启动成功。
- (可选)如果启用了系统防火墙,需放行 22 端口:
sudo ufw allow ssh
安装完成后,您可以使用以下命令查看本机 IP 地址,供远程连接使用:
ip addr show
获取 CosLogin Browser 安装包
您可以根据实际环境选择以下任意一种方式获取安装文件 CosLogin_Browser-0.0.1-linux-amd64.deb。
方式一:通过 SFTP/SCP 上传(适用于从其他电脑传输)
假设安装包已在您的本地 Windows 或 macOS 主机上下载完成,且 Ubuntu 的 IP 地址为 192.168.1.100,用户名为 ubuntu,上传步骤如下:
- 使用
scp命令(在 Mac/Linux 终端或 Windows PowerShell 中执行):
scp CosLogin_Browser-0.0.1-linux-amd64.deb ubuntu@192.168.1.100:~
- 或使用图形化 SFTP 客户端(如 FileZilla、WinSCP)连接到 Ubuntu,将 deb 包拖拽至目标目录(例如
/home/ubuntu/)。
上传完成后,在 Ubuntu 终端中进入该目录即可看到文件。
方式二:直接在 Ubuntu 系统内下载
- 在 Ubuntu 桌面环境中打开浏览器,访问 CosLogin Browser 官方网站。
- 找到 Linux 版安装包下载链接,选择适用于 amd64 架构的
.deb文件并下载。通常文件会保存在~/Downloads目录。 - 在终端中进入下载目录:
cd ~/Downloads
安装 CosLogin Browser
确认当前目录中存在 CosLogin_Browser-0.0.1-linux-amd64.deb 文件后,执行以下命令安装。
- (推荐)更新软件包列表并修复可能存在的依赖关系:
sudo apt update
- 使用
apt安装本地 deb 包:
sudo apt install ./CosLogin_Browser-0.0.1-linux-amd64.deb
安装过程中会自动解析并安装必要的依赖项。
- 如果安装时提示依赖错误,可运行以下命令尝试修复,然后重新执行安装:
sudo apt --fix-broken install
注意:请勿使用dpkg -i直接安装,因为dpkg不会自动处理依赖,容易导致缺失组件的错误。apt install ./包名是推荐的安装方式。
启动 CosLogin Browser
安装完成后,您可以通过桌面环境或终端来启动应用。
- 图形界面启动:点击屏幕左下角的“应用程序”菜单,在搜索框中输入 “CosLogin” 或 “Browser”,找到 CosLogin Browser 图标并单击即可运行。如果未立即出现,可尝试注销当前用户后重新登录。
- 终端启动:在终端中输入以下命令并回车(具体命令以安装后生成的可执行文件名称为准):
coslogin-browser
若命令无法找到,请检查 /usr/bin 或 /opt 下是否存在相关可执行文件,或参阅应用程序菜单中快捷方式的属性。
验证安装结果
- 应用成功启动后,界面应展示登录页面,并可正常输入腾讯云账号信息进行认证。
- 在终端中执行以下命令,可查看已安装的 CosLogin Browser 包信息:
dpkg -l | grep coslogin
如输出包含 coslogin-browser 及其版本号 0.0.1,则表示安装成功。
常见问题与排错
安装依赖出错
- 现象:执行
sudo apt install ./CosLogin_Browser-0.0.1-linux-amd64.deb后,终端提示unmet dependencies。 - 解决方法:依次执行:
sudo apt update
sudo apt --fix-broken install
然后重新运行安装命令。如果仍无法解决,请检查系统是否已启用 universe 软件源(通常已默认启用)。
SSH 连接被拒绝
- 现象:远程使用
scp或sftp时提示Connection refused。 - 检查项:
- Ubuntu 上的 SSH 服务是否已启动:
sudo systemctl status ssh - 防火墙是否拦截:
sudo ufw status,如未放行请执行sudo ufw allow ssh - 虚拟机网络模式是否设置为桥接或 NAT(确保主机能 ping 通 Ubuntu 的 IP)
终端中找不到 coslogin-browser 命令
- 现象:输入
coslogin-browser显示command not found。 - 解决方法:使用
dpkg -L coslogin-browser查看该包安装的所有文件,搜索名为coslogin或browser的可执行文件路径,然后使用完整路径启动,或将该路径加入PATH环境变量。多数情况下,通过应用程序菜单启动即可。
安装后图标不显示
- 现象:在应用程序菜单中搜不到 CosLogin Browser。
- 解决方法:执行以下命令刷新桌面数据库,或注销后重新登录:
sudo update-desktop-database
结果检查
至此,您已在 Ubuntu 24.04 系统上成功安装 CosLogin Browser。启动应用后,请使用腾讯云 API 密钥或账号密码登录,即可开始管理您的 COS 资源。若遇到任何登录或使用问题,请参考产品的后续帮助文档或联系技术支持。